2005 GMC Savana vs. 1966 Jaguar 420G
To start off, 2005 GMC Savana is newer by 39 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1966 Jaguar 420G.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1966 Jaguar 420G would be higher. At 4,293 cc (6 cylinders), 2005 GMC Savana is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1966 Jaguar 420G (255 HP) has 60 more horse power than 2005 GMC Savana. (195 HP) In normal driving conditions, 1966 Jaguar 420G should accelerate faster than 2005 GMC Savana.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2005 GMC Savana weights approximately 552 kg more than 1966 Jaguar 420G.
Let's talk about torque, 1966 Jaguar 420G (373 Nm) has 20 more torque (in Nm) than 2005 GMC Savana. (353 Nm). This means 1966 Jaguar 420G will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2005 GMC Savana.
Compare all specifications:
2005 GMC Savana | 1966 Jaguar 420G | |
Make | GMC | Jaguar |
Model | Savana | 420G |
Year Released | 2005 | 1966 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 4293 cc | 4235 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Horse Power | 195 HP | 255 HP |
Torque | 353 Nm | 373 Nm |
Engine Bore Size | 102 mm | 92.1 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 88 mm | 106 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 9.2:1 | 8.0:1 |
Number of Seats | 8 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 2330 kg | 1778 kg |
Vehicle Length | 5700 mm | 5140 mm |
Vehicle Width | 2020 mm | 1910 mm |
Vehicle Height | 2080 mm | 1390 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 3440 mm | 3050 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 117 L | 90 L |
